About 4-tert-butyl-5-chloro-2-fluoropyridine
4-tert-butyl-5-chloro-2-fluoropyridine (PubChem CID 59233319) has the molecular formula C9H11ClFN
and a molecular weight of 187.65 g/mol. Its IUPAC name is 4-tert-butyl-5-chloro-2-fluoropyridine.
